One of the standout features of the DC HOUSE battery is its Low Temperature Cut-Off Protection. This upgraded technology ensures that the battery operates safely in extreme conditions. When the temperature drops below 32℉, the Battery Management System (BMS) automatically cuts off the charging function, preventing potential damage. Additionally, if the temperature falls below -7.6℉, the battery will cease discharging until temperatures rise above 0℉. This feature is particularly beneficial for those in colder climates, as it protects the battery from harsh conditions while prolonging its lifespan.

Speaking of lifespan, the longevity of this lithium iron phosphate battery is truly remarkable. With the capability to be recharged more than 4000 times, and potentially exceeding 15000 cycles, it far surpasses the lifespan of traditional lead-acid batteries, which typically only manage 300-400 cycles. Buying Guide for 200Ah Deep Cycle Batteries

Understanding Deep Cycle Batteries

When I first started looking into deep cycle batteries, I quickly learned that they are designed to provide a steady amount of power over a long period. Unlike starting batteries, which deliver a quick burst of energy for starting engines, deep cycle batteries are built to be discharged and recharged repeatedly. This makes them ideal for applications like RVs, solar power systems, and marine use.

Why Choose a 200Ah Capacity?

The 200Ah capacity is a sweet spot for many users. I found that it offers a good balance between power and weight. For my needs, this capacity allows me to run appliances and devices for an extended period without needing to recharge constantly. Whether I’m powering a refrigerator in my RV or running lights during a camping trip, I appreciate the extended runtime a 200Ah battery provides.

Types of Deep Cycle Batteries

In my research, I discovered that there are several types of deep cycle batteries, including flooded lead-acid, AGM (Absorbent Glass Mat), and lithium-ion. Each type has its pros and cons. Flooded lead-acid batteries are often more affordable but require regular maintenance. AGM batteries are maintenance-free and can handle deeper discharges but may come at a higher price. Lithium-ion batteries offer the best performance and longevity but are usually the most expensive option.

Check the Discharge Rate

I learned that the discharge rate is crucial when selecting a deep cycle battery. It indicates how quickly the battery can deliver power. If I’m using the battery for high-drain devices, I need to ensure that it can handle that load without affecting performance. It’s essential to check the specifications to find a battery that suits my power needs.

Charging Options

Understanding charging options was another critical factor for me. I found that some batteries require specific chargers to avoid damage. I made sure to choose a charging system that matched my battery type, ensuring efficient charging and longevity. Additionally, I considered how quickly I wanted the battery to recharge, which varies by type.

Longevity and Cycle Life

The longevity of a battery is something I took seriously. I looked into the cycle life, which indicates how many times I can fully discharge and recharge the battery before its performance starts to decline. A longer cycle life means I won’t have to replace the battery as frequently, which is a significant cost-saving in the long run.
